This example shows how to use the prebuilt MATLAB interface for the OpenCV function cv::Fast in MATLAB to detect keypoints in an image. Additionally, use the keyPointsToStruct utility function to write the keypoints returned by the OpenCV cv::Fast function to a MATLAB structure.
Add the MATLAB interface to OpenCV package names to the import list.
import clib.opencv.*; import vision.opencv.util.*;
Read an image into the MATLAB workspace.
img = imread("elephant.jpg");Create MATLAB interface objects for the OpenCV MatND and InputArray classes to store the input image.
[inputMat,inputArray] = createMat(img);
Create a MATLAB interface object for the OpenCV KeyPoint vector by using the clibArray function.
keyPointsVec = clibArray("clib.opencv.cv.KeyPoint",0);Specify the parameters for computing keypoints using the FAST detector.
threshold = 100; nonmaxSuppression = true;
Compute keypoints in the image by calling the OpenCV function cv::FAST in MATLAB.
cv.FAST(inputArray,keyPointsVec,threshold,nonmaxSuppression);
Convert the KeyPoints object returned by the OpenCV function into a MATLAB structure.
mlstruct = keyPointsToStruct(keyPointsVec);
Inspect the fields in the output MATLAB structure.
mlstruct
mlstruct = struct with fields:
Location: [48×2 double]
Scale: [48×1 double]
Metric: [48×1 double]
Misc: [48×1 double]
Orientation: [48×1 double]
Display the input image and plot the detected keypoints.
figure imshow(img) hold on plot(mlstruct.Location(:,1),mlstruct.Location(:,2),"*r") hold off

Input Arguments
OpenCV KeyPoints class, specified as a MATLAB interface object. This interface object is a representation of the
KeyPoints class returned by any of the OpenCV functions for
keypoint detection.
Output Arguments
Keypoints detected using the OpenCV function, returned as a MATLAB structure with fields Location,
Scale, Metric, Misc, and
Orientation.
| Fields | Description |
Location | x and y-coordinates of the keypoints. |
Scale | Diameter of the neighborhood region around the keypoints. |
Metric | Strength of the keypoints. |
Orientation | Orientation of the keypoints. |
